NCL Research & Financial Services  (BOM:530557) Capex-to-Revenue Explanation

Capex-to-Revenue measures a company's investments in physical assets such as property, industrial buildings or equipment to its revenue. The ratio shows how aggressively the company reinvests its revenue back into productive assets. However, a high ratio potentially indicates that the company has invested too much in innovation and infrastructure, taking up funds that could be used to boost productivity and increase revenue. Therefore, a high Capex to Revenue Ratio could be a positive or a negative sign depending on how effectively a company converts those investments into future earnings.

NCL Research & Financial Services Ltd is a Non-Banking financing company engaged in the business of finance and investments. It trades in both the Equity and FNO Segment and also in the Commodities market along with its financing activities. The company generates the majority of its revenue from Interest Income.
